There are some popular sentences in chatting rooms ,which can be useful for start-leaners to begin talking easily.Here they are:

  • How are you doing
  • I'm doing great.
  • What's up
  • Nothing special.
  • Hi Long time no see.
  • So far so good.
  • Things couldn't be better.
  • How about yourself?
  • Today is a great day.
  • Are you making progress
  • May I have your name, please
  • I've heard so much about you.
  • I hope you're enjoying your staying here.
  • Let's get together again.
  • That's a great idea!
  • Please say hello to your mother for me.
  • I'm glad to have met you.
  • Don't forget us.
  • Keep in touch .
  • I had a wonderful time here .
